Electronic phonon-induced magnetism in moiré Mott-Wigner crystals

Weide Liang, Xiaoying Du, Na Zhang, Hongyi Yu

We show that magnetism in moiré Mott-Wigner crystals can be induced by the collective vibration of electrons around their equilibrium positions (i.e., electronic phonons), even without spin interactions between electrons. Due to a geometric valley-orbit coupling from the Berry phase effect, the zero-point energy of electronic phonons reaches minimum when electrons are fully valley polarized. This leads to a spontaneous magnetization when below a critical temperature. We also propose to engineer the magnetism through the photoexcitation of chiral electronic phonons.
